Every day, Blarney Castle, located near the Irish city of Cork, attracts thousands or even tens of thousands of people from all over the world. And all in order to kiss the famous Speech Stone – the most unhygienic landmark in Europe.

And millions of people around the world can boast of kissing the Blarney Stone, also known as the Stone of Eloquence.
Traditionally, it is believed that this object is part of the Skunk Stone - one of the symbols of Scotland, on which the monarchs of this country, and later Great Britain, were crowned since ancient times. King Robert the Bruce allegedly donated part of the historical block to the Irish feudal lord Cormac McCarthy for his help in the war against the British.
This stone began to be associated with the acquisition of eloquence in the sixteenth century, when Queen Elizabeth of England sent her confidant to Blarney to negotiate with the owner the conditions for the transfer of the stronghold to the rule of the British crown. However, for a long time, the envoy was never able to start an appropriate conversation with the local feudal lord - he always found some excuses. This is how a legend appeared that has survived to this day.
Thanks to her, Blarney Castle is the most visited in all of Ireland. Thousands of people go there to stand in a huge line for the opportunity to kiss the Stone of Eloquence and find the corresponding gift. This is despite the fact that the travel site Tripster in 2009 declared this object the most unhygienic attraction in Europe.
The famous writer Chuck Palahniuk also scoffs at this. In the novel "Fight Club", the protagonist says that he committed the first act of vandalism in Blarney Castle, urinating on the Stone of Speech.
